| Iowa State coach Dan McCarney resigns Iowa State coach Dan McCarney, the longest tenured coach in the Big 12, announced that he will resign following the end of the season. Telling reporters that "Sometimes you have to put the organization ahead of yourself" and that "the best thing for this program right now is for me to step down," McCarney announced that his 12th season on the Cyclones sideline would be his last.
